#033868 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#033868 is composed of 1.2% red, 22%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.1% cyan, 46.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 59.2% black. It has a hue angle of 208.5 degrees, a saturation of 94.4% and a lightness of 21%. #033868 color hex could be obtained by blending #0670d0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

Shades and Tints of #033868

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000509 is the darkest color, while #f5faff is the lightest one.

Tones of #033868

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#343637 is the less saturated color, while #033868 is the most saturated one.
